The Calgary Stampede is right around the corner, and we cannot wait to celebrate the best ten days of the year with you, YYC! We are so excited for this years' shows, food, events, shopping and western spirit. In celebration of Stampede being less than one month away, here are some fun facts about this years' Greatest Outdoor Show on Earth:

  • The parade marshal this year is Jeremy Hansen! "Hansen will become the first Canadian to venture to the moon as part of the historic Artemis II mission. It’s the first crewed mission to leave Earth’s orbit since 1972 and will pave the way for deeper space exploration, including to Mars" (The Calgary Stampede).

  • Try Ice Fishing: "Go ice fishing this weekend. During Alberta’s twice-yearly Family Fishing Weekends, no fishing licence is required. Albertans and visitors are invited to give fishing a try on waterbodies with open fishing seasons (not in national parks). Keep in mind that fishing regulations still apply." (To Do Canada)
